STEM and Racket Club

At Foljambe, we kicked off the year with a new after-school club for KS2, offering STEM activities alongside a racket club. The club has run successfully throughout the half term, giving children the chance to have fun, explore ideas, and learn new skills.

Each week, the sessions end with a home-cooked meal, which the children have thoroughly enjoyed. For the final week of the term, we celebrated Valentine’s Day. The children built hearts using Lego and created paper hearts to join together, making a colourful and creative structure. It’s been a fantastic half term, full of learning, creativity, and fun!
